466568867 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 466568868. Its totient is φ = 466568866.
The previous prime is 466568863. The next prime is 466568891. The reversal of 466568867 is 768865664.
It is a happy number.
It is a weak prime.
It is a cyclic number.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 466568867 - 22 = 466568863 is a prime.
It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(466568863) by changing a digit.
It is a pernicious number, because its binary representation contains a prime number (17) of ones.
It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 233284433 + 233284434.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(233284434).
Almost surely, 2466568867 is an apocalyptic number.
466568867 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).
466568867 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.
466568867 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.
The product of its digits is 11612160, while the sum is 56.
The square root of 466568867 is about 21600.2052536544. The cubic root of 466568867 is about 775.6014017992.
The spelling of 466568867 in words is "four hundred sixty-six million, five hundred sixty-eight thousand, eight hundred sixty-seven".
